Harnessing Pumpkin Yields with AI

The age-old quest for amplifying pumpkin yields is getting a technological boost thanks to the power of machine intelligence. Data-driven algorithms are being deployed to analyze vast sets of data on factors such as soil quality, weather conditions, and planting methods. These insights can help farmers forecast yields more accurately, adjust their farming practices in real time, and ultimately produce healthier, more abundant pumpkin harvests.

  • Example one innovative AI system that can analyze satellite imagery to detect areas of stress in pumpkin plants. By highlighting these issues early on, farmers can take action promptly and reduce potential damage.
  • Another groundbreaking application involves using AI to predict pumpkin prices based on supply and demand. This can help farmers devise more savvy decisions about when to collect their pumpkins for maximum profit.

Therefore, AI is poised to disrupt the pumpkin industry, increasing yields while promoting sustainable farming practices. From sapling to harvest, AI is guiding farmers in every step of the journey, unveiling the true capacity of this beloved autumnal fruit.
